Texture of Talc carbonate and Rhyolite

Characteristics related to grain size of rocks are called as texture. Here you can know more about texture of Talc carbonate and Rhyolite. Texture of Talc carbonate is Very Soft whereas that of Rhyolite is Aphanitic, Glassy, Porphyritic. Based on the texture of rocks, they are used for various purposes.
